What Does an AC Repair Technician Do?
When the summer heat becomes unbearable, your air conditioner turns into your best friend. But like any machine, it can break down or lose efficiency over time. That’s when an AC repair technician comes to the rescue. These professionals specialize in diagnosing, repairing, installing, and maintaining air conditioning systems to ensure you stay comfortable year-round.
1. Diagnosing Problems
One of the most important jobs of an AC technician is identifying issues with the unit. Whether it’s strange noises, weak airflow, leaking water, or the system blowing warm air, technicians use their expertise and specialized tools to detect the root cause.
2. Repairing Faulty Parts
Once the problem is identified, technicians handle the necessary repairs. This could include replacing filters, repairing electrical components, fixing refrigerant leaks, unclogging drain lines, or even replacing a damaged compressor. Their goal is to restore the AC unit to optimal performance.
3. Performing Routine Maintenance
Regular maintenance is essential for extending the lifespan of your AC. Technicians provide tune-ups such as:
-
Cleaning coils and filters
-
Checking refrigerant levels
-
Inspecting electrical wiring
-
Lubricating moving parts
-
Ensuring thermostat accuracy
These preventive steps help reduce breakdowns and improve efficiency.
4. Installing New AC Units
In cases where the old system can’t be repaired or isn’t energy-efficient, AC technicians also handle new installations. They help customers choose the right unit based on room size, budget, and cooling needs, then install it properly to ensure smooth operation.
5. Providing Expert Advice
Beyond repairs and installation, technicians guide customers on energy-saving tips, proper usage, and when it’s time to replace an outdated system. Their advice helps homeowners and businesses save money in the long run.
